Three Teams and Their Energy Efficient Cars From India on Their way to Compete at Shell Eco-marathon 2018, Singapore

NEW DELHI, March 5, 2018 --

Shell Companies in India wishes bon voyage and the very best to the winners of the India leg of the Shell Eco-marathon Asia 2018 challenger round as they leave for the main event to be held in Singapore between March 8 and March 11, 2018. A key highlight of the annual Make the Future event held at Changi Exhibition Centre, Singapore, the Shell Eco-marathon Asia 2018 is a unique competition that challenges student teams from the region to design, build, drive and compete to create the world's most energy efficient vehicles.

This ninth edition of the competition will see student teams from across Asia-Pacific and the Middle East put their self-built fuel-efficient vehicles to the test on a custom-built track. It will feature bright energy ideas and innovations that address the global energy challenge - how to generate more energy, while producing less CO2. Student teams that take to the track will be awarded on the criteria of who goes further on the least amount of fuel. Teams from India have earlier won the off track Perseverance and Team spirit award in 2016 and 2017.

The three winning teams from India for the 2018 competition include:   

  • Team Futuramic, a team of 24 members from Sir M Visvesvaraya Institute of Technology, Bengaluru, Karnataka, participating under the Gasoline category with their car, Atharva 2.0. Powered by a 100cc motorcycle engine, the car is expected to provide a mileage of 100+ kmpl
  • Team Supermileage from Delhi Technical University , a group of 35-40 students who have come up with a workable fuel-efficient battery electric vehicle prototype expected to provide a mileage of 150/Kms in a single charge
  • Team Averera, a group of 11 students from Indian Institute of Technology, Varanasi who are designing an electric vehicle prototype expected to provide a mileage of 350 km/hr

The top teams from Shell Eco-marathon Asia 2018 will also compete in the Drivers' World Championship Asia in March with the winner representing Asia at the Drivers' World Championship Global Finals in London.

Shell in India 

Shell is one of the most diversified international oil company in India's energy sector with over 6,000 employees. It is a major private sector supplier of crude products, chemicals and technology to public/private sector oil companies. It maintains a significant presence in the country with its lubricants and retail businesses. Shell also has a technology center, a financial business operations center, an in-house global IT center and operates a joint venture LNG receiving and re-gasification terminal. Through its subsidiary company BG Exploration and Production India Limited, Shell holds a 30% interest in, and is joint operator of, the Panna - Mukta oil and gas fields and the Mid and South Tapti gas and condensate fields (PMT fields). Shell also holds a 32.5% equity stake in Mahanagar Gas Limited (MGL). MGL has to its credit the distinction of pioneering the natural gas distribution network in Mumbai and its neighboring areas.
